m4a

    0热度

    1回答

    我已经尝试在解码器文件中用finch放入解码选项以获取.m4a文件播放,但是当它实际播放声音时,它会出现静态。关于如何获得这项工作的任何想法? 感谢

    0热度

    1回答

    我的应用程序需要将大量音频数据编码为M4A文件。我目前使用AVAssetWriter,它工作正常,但需要几分钟时间来编码所有数据。 而不是要求用户保持应用程序运行,直到该过程完成,我想暂停编码,当应用程序终止并继续重新启动。 不幸的是,AVAssetWriter似乎不支持这一点,因为它在初始化时总是会创建一个新文件。 你知道我可以使用的其他任何API吗?也许是第三方库?

    5热度

    2回答

    我看了,似乎无法找到具体的答案。 我的客户想要在他的网站上播放声音剪辑,目前他有超过2000个m4a格式的剪辑。 我看过的很多音频播放器都说它们支持mp4,但没有提及m4a。 从wiki上的mp4它说,他们都是一样的,除了m4a是一个容器mp4或沿着这些线路的东西。 所以我的问题是我可以用mp4播放器播放m4a文件吗? 另一种方法是让我的客户将他所有的文件转换为mp3。 什么是最好的前进方向?

    2热度

    1回答

    我写了一个简单的媒体播放器,使用java声音和一堆不同的SPI来支持各种音频格式。尽管如此,我仍然无法找到.m4a的SPI。我看过JAAD,但它似乎只有AAC的SPI,而不是M4A。 那里有一个吗?

    4热度

    1回答

    我试图播放一些.m4a文件,并且我知道JAAD仅支持解码AAC,但有些歌曲能够获取sourceDataLine,然后当我去尝试播放它们时,我得到这样的行为: 我们阅读:1024字节。 我们阅读:512字节。 我们阅读:-1个字节。 运行此: // read from the input bytesRead = audioInputStream.read(tempBuffer, 0, tempBu

    0热度

    1回答

    我遇到了将M4A原子插入文件的问题。由于原始文件没有udta结构,因此我使用现有的M4A文件添加它作为指南。 这里就是我所做的添加原子: 内建内存 更新MOOV原子大小的UDTA原子包括对UDTA原子 将文件复制起来的大小到第一个trak原子的末端 插入我的udta原子 照常复制剩下的部分。 原始文件和标记文件之间唯一真正的区别是mdat原子已经向下移动一点以适应标记。这使我相信在其他原子中有一些

    1热度

    1回答

    我遇到了标记MP4/M4A文件的问题。标记操作变为A- OK。那么,我有一个stco原子的问题,但我解决了这个问题。但现在,当我播放MP4文件时,mplayer给我一个错误: [mov,mp4,m4a,3gp,3g2,mj2 @ 0x29db0a0] wrong sample count 但是,文件确实播放。 有谁知道我错过了什么?这是我为了将我的标记原子添加到MP4文件而做的。我有一种感觉,

    5热度

    2回答

    我有一个使用FAAC将原始PCM转换为原始AAC的Android应用程序,但现在我不知道如何将它打包到m4a容器中。 我在网上搜索过,发现很多信息,但没有一个能解决我的问题。他们中的大多数都提到ffmpeg/mp4box命令行,但我需要的是在Android环境中解决这个问题,这意味着Java Eclipse或JNI。 有什么提示吗?

    0热度

    2回答

    我需要一个可以将AAC音频流转换为M4A的库。我们所面临的问题,同时播放AAC搭载Android 2.3.3的HTC Desire,我们得到这个错误: MediaPlayer.MEDIA_ERROR_SERVER_DIED (100) 我想知道如果有,我可以遵循AAC转换成M4A或任何规范可以利用的图书馆。

    6热度

    2回答

    我已经写了一些PHP代码来从mp3文件中提取ID3标签。下一步是对.m4a文件做同样的处理。从我做的研究看来,大多数m4a文件不使用ID3,而是使用“原子”的格式。 是否有任何PHP库可以解析出这些'原子'?我见过一些C#/ C++,但没有找到任何PHP的。任何其他指南或文档也会很棒。 感谢